summaryrefslogtreecommitdiffstats
Commit message (Collapse)AuthorAgeFilesLines
* Log APK hash for package install attempts in the Event Log.Alex Klyubin2013-10-154-12/+119
| | | | | | | | | | This CL adds a package_digest field to the install_package_attempt event. The field is populated with the SHA-256 digest of the contents of the APK iff the user has consented to app verification and app verification is enabled. Bug: 10605940 Change-Id: I0d191398ed8d28950c7b5ee0ce02ec077d2c888b
* am ce20cd4a: (-s ours) am 4a46caba: (-s ours) am ed7edbd7: (-s ours) Import ↵Baligh Uddin2013-10-110-0/+0
|\ | | | | | | | | | | | | translations. DO NOT MERGE * commit 'ce20cd4a22076afdb58e49ae881167871dc7e064': Import translations. DO NOT MERGE
| * am 4a46caba: (-s ours) am ed7edbd7: (-s ours) Import translations. DO NOT MERGEBaligh Uddin2013-10-110-0/+0
| |\ | | | | | | | | | | | | * commit '4a46cabaf51a3e4369c808aa3241eedf6844ed92': Import translations. DO NOT MERGE
| | * am ed7edbd7: (-s ours) Import translations. DO NOT MERGEBaligh Uddin2013-10-110-0/+0
| | |\ | | | | | | | | | | | | | | | | * commit 'ed7edbd7192d2c1486ca4f39b926128660e6edb1': Import translations. DO NOT MERGE
| | | * Import translations. DO NOT MERGEBaligh Uddin2013-10-101-1/+1
| | | | | | | | | | | | | | | | | | | | Change-Id: Iae5e69cdfe2a5b403d5879850dd65a7822f68d9e Auto-generated-cl: translation import
* | | | am 6a5bb0d3: (-s ours) am 87b15e21: (-s ours) Import translations. DO NOT MERGEBaligh Uddin2013-10-110-0/+0
|\| | | | | | | | | | | | | | | | | | | * commit '6a5bb0d3a374aefce517642482cbf6d9744cf927': Import translations. DO NOT MERGE
| * | | am 87b15e21: (-s ours) Import translations. DO NOT MERGEBaligh Uddin2013-10-110-0/+0
| |\| | | | | | | | | | | | | | | | | | * commit '87b15e21a94902ba95a44c538ca00cedc4057ff0': Import translations. DO NOT MERGE
| | * | Import translations. DO NOT MERGEBaligh Uddin2013-10-101-1/+1
| | | | | | | | | | | | | | | | | | | | Change-Id: I0b7d1299e07ababd3b2bb708b85f852e80969abc Auto-generated-cl: translation import
* | | | Import translations. DO NOT MERGEBaligh Uddin2013-10-101-1/+1
| | | | | | | | | | | | | | | | | | | | Change-Id: I022b09c9c8b8ba6809e7e5ec4fc8f04d73a41e96 Auto-generated-cl: translation import
* | | | am febcd0ab: (-s ours) am 0aa290a7: (-s ours) am 1e2fad8b: (-s ours) Import ↵Baligh Uddin2013-10-040-0/+0
|\| | | | | | | | | | | | | | | | | | | | | | | | | | | translations. DO NOT MERGE * commit 'febcd0abcd059fc1e18ba3f68db991b1b3b67663': Import translations. DO NOT MERGE
| * | | am 0aa290a7: (-s ours) am 1e2fad8b: (-s ours) Import translations. DO NOT MERGEBaligh Uddin2013-10-040-0/+0
| |\| | | | | | | | | | | | | | | | | | * commit '0aa290a769995107410e4e49ce7fb2770c91457d': Import translations. DO NOT MERGE
| | * | am 1e2fad8b: (-s ours) Import translations. DO NOT MERGEBaligh Uddin2013-10-040-0/+0
| | |\| | | | | | | | | | | | | | | | | * commit '1e2fad8b8b42ced75627675430157f1e878017ea': Import translations. DO NOT MERGE
| | | * Import translations. DO NOT MERGEBaligh Uddin2013-10-046-14/+14
| | | | | | | | | | | | | | | | | | | | Change-Id: I6d18df83117a8c2fdbcf4e6500146d3d9d21517c Auto-generated-cl: translation import
* | | | am c393548d: (-s ours) am 00577db7: (-s ours) Import translations. DO NOT MERGEBaligh Uddin2013-10-040-0/+0
|\| | | | | | | | | | | | | | | | | | | * commit 'c393548d8cf90c2ca58774f7ede1d9a4fe4f1b5d': Import translations. DO NOT MERGE
| * | | am 00577db7: (-s ours) Import translations. DO NOT MERGEBaligh Uddin2013-10-040-0/+0
| |\| | | | | | | | | | | | | | | | | | * commit '00577db7cfb3c8f514c2766449d87d16cab88617': Import translations. DO NOT MERGE
| | * | Import translations. DO NOT MERGEBaligh Uddin2013-10-046-14/+14
| | |/ | | | | | | | | | | | | Change-Id: I835c2207ed0a66cb910fd629544c16fcbd9d75e6 Auto-generated-cl: translation import
* | | Import translations. DO NOT MERGEBaligh Uddin2013-10-044-8/+8
| | | | | | | | | | | | | | | Change-Id: I187eee3755302b09b01e66fbf4cc7e1cfa6c2fb1 Auto-generated-cl: translation import
* | | Import translations. DO NOT MERGEBaligh Uddin2013-10-022-5/+5
| | | | | | | | | | | | | | | Change-Id: Icaff3eb3adf55b670176c9d34181443b7889c121 Auto-generated-cl: translation import
* | | Import translations. DO NOT MERGEBaligh Uddin2013-09-301-1/+1
| | | | | | | | | | | | | | | Change-Id: Id78ff62bc42474433168b460896253b07b9cc694 Auto-generated-cl: translation import
* | | am 91fc832e: (-s ours) am eb2ee40c: (-s ours) Import translations. DO NOT MERGEBaligh Uddin2013-09-250-0/+0
|\| | | | | | | | | | | | | | * commit '91fc832e74b7c98763107455585a9ee6b9552571': Import translations. DO NOT MERGE
| * | am eb2ee40c: (-s ours) Import translations. DO NOT MERGEBaligh Uddin2013-09-250-0/+0
| |\| | | | | | | | | | | | | * commit 'eb2ee40ca3b17f75d06f53af21acd050c80462a0': Import translations. DO NOT MERGE
| | * Import translations. DO NOT MERGEBaligh Uddin2013-09-252-30/+30
| | | | | | | | | | | | | | | Change-Id: I808c9dea6e0eb2acfa0401ec7bf0e25d8c11384c Auto-generated-cl: translation import
* | | am ef9eaa28: am a17dcac3: Merge "Robustify logging of analytics about ↵Alex Klyubin2013-09-242-65/+42
|\| | | | | | | | | | | | | | | | | | | | PackageInstaller." into klp-dev * commit 'ef9eaa2865e1a415603a5f8bc67cc1918c677233': Robustify logging of analytics about PackageInstaller.
| * | am a17dcac3: Merge "Robustify logging of analytics about PackageInstaller." ↵Alex Klyubin2013-09-232-65/+42
| |\| | | | | | | | | | | | | | | | | | | into klp-dev * commit 'a17dcac3fe8f7b6e65bfa509f5d5479756cbec19': Robustify logging of analytics about PackageInstaller.
| | * Merge "Robustify logging of analytics about PackageInstaller." into klp-devAlex Klyubin2013-09-232-65/+42
| | |\
| | | * Robustify logging of analytics about PackageInstaller.Alex Klyubin2013-09-102-65/+42
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| This CL switches from the type-unsafe EventLog.writeEvent method to the strictly-typed EventLogTags.writeInstallPackageAttempt. This method is generated from the definition of this event in EventLogTags.logtags and thus offers compile-time type checking. Bug: 10605940 Change-Id: I62895b60fe4c01d4314eba564476e0f1ed7ad78b
* | | | Import translations. DO NOT MERGEBaligh Uddin2013-09-192-30/+30
| | | | | | | | | | | | | | | | | | | | Change-Id: Icdea2a46cf69be555b65acc78dfd08bc77adf992 Auto-generated-cl: translation import
* | | | am d2991e8f: (-s ours) am 9222a09d: (-s ours) Import translations. DO NOT MERGEBaligh Uddin2013-09-140-0/+0
|\| | | | | | | | | | | | | | | | | | | * commit 'd2991e8fbcc6ea60ef6b9fcdac090dc6578e1735': Import translations. DO NOT MERGE
| * | | am 9222a09d: (-s ours) Import translations. DO NOT MERGEBaligh Uddin2013-09-140-0/+0
| |\| | | | |/ | |/| | | | | | | * commit '9222a09d4c1c8fb6aea73e2583235071baed88a7': Import translations. DO NOT MERGE
| | * Import translations. DO NOT MERGEBaligh Uddin2013-09-1416-38/+859
| |/ | | | | | | | | Change-Id: I0edd4735e9e5616ae88beab41f3ee18bbfe39d0b Auto-generated-cl: translation import
* | Import translations. DO NOT MERGEBaligh Uddin2013-09-132-10/+10
| | | | | | | | | | Change-Id: I2d58642feb7e673108cf95cb08f7b53f7dd58432 Auto-generated-cl: translation import
* | Import translations. DO NOT MERGEBaligh Uddin2013-09-113-24/+24
| | | | | | | | | | Change-Id: If8c25beec627c5551af84d9eeec1e5f543155969 Auto-generated-cl: translation import
* | am 71510286: Merge "Record analytics about package install attempts to Event ↵Alex Klyubin2013-09-106-37/+650
|\| | | | | | | | | | | | | Log." into klp-dev * commit '71510286b8ed1d116b0cf234254dcbd8316ff751': Record analytics about package install attempts to Event Log.
| * Merge "Record analytics about package install attempts to Event Log." into ↵Alex Klyubin2013-09-106-37/+650
| |\ | | | | | | | | | klp-dev
| | * Record analytics about package install attempts to Event Log.Alex Klyubin2013-09-096-37/+650
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| The purpose of this change is to provide analytics about the various stages of the install flow. Recorded information does not contain user-, device-, or package/app-identifying information. Examples of recorded information are: * duration of the flow (start to finish) * duration of the flow until the moment the user clicks Install * whether the attempt is an update or a new install. * whether app verification is enabled. * whether Unknown Sources is enabled. * whether the attempt was blocked by Unknown Sources. * whether permissions were displayed. * error code (if any) returned by PackageManager when installing the package. Bug: 10605940 Change-Id: I9bc009223a365a558cdf02bd91cf4315b82564c2
* | | am e1c0ad6d: Fix bug #10397732 \'X\' icon of download manager UI error not ↵Fabrice Di Meglio2013-09-061-1/+2
|\| | | | | | | | | | | | | | | | | | | | mirrored * commit 'e1c0ad6d82bd4c4ba5c65e4951c5fcba170b2f55': Fix bug #10397732 'X' icon of download manager UI error not mirrored
| * | Fix bug #10397732 'X' icon of download manager UI error not mirroredFabrice Di Meglio2013-09-061-1/+2
| |/ | | | | | | | | | | - use TextView.setCompoundDrawablesRelative() instead of setCompoundDrawables() Change-Id: I4021236aa40d92ed9df0e354b8ce2287afa51168
* | Import translations. DO NOT MERGEBaligh Uddin2013-09-031-1/+1
| | | | | | | | | | Change-Id: Ie5b607a80fd1607abbeb6385b1d53b3f4306f3d4 Auto-generated-cl: translation import
* | Import translations. DO NOT MERGEBaligh Uddin2013-08-283-2/+166
| | | | | | | | | | Change-Id: I806b53e2674ef3b703eb3567d5f1502435749d72 Auto-generated-cl: translation import
* | Import translations. DO NOT MERGEBaligh Uddin2013-08-268-0/+657
| | | | | | | | | | Change-Id: I2b1953f3860073e943e2cceea3b69062ffdd0eea Auto-generated-cl: translation import
* | Import translations. DO NOT MERGEBaligh Uddin2013-08-211-3/+3
| | | | | | | | | | Change-Id: I14aa8cb182e1c44364b53a63d0ec39de2a27e9e7 Auto-generated-cl: translation import
* | Import translations. DO NOT MERGEBaligh Uddin2013-08-1911-0/+903
|/ | | | | Change-Id: I3d6ccd9e54116289414bf8c3e515331ac3a26acd Auto-generated-cl: translation import
* Import translations. DO NOT MERGEBaligh Uddin2013-08-0148-144/+144
| | | | | Change-Id: Iec4b403a0a40f6eab5c05635b373d9a53141e9d7 Auto-generated-cl: translation import
* Import translations. DO NOT MERGEBaligh Uddin2013-07-291-1/+1
| | | | | Change-Id: I62dc26ed226f7e31f715435339cbe3ad0b227cef Auto-generated-cl: translation import
* Import translations. DO NOT MERGEBaligh Uddin2013-06-241-1/+1
| | | | | Change-Id: I51ad29f77da17e223b6182b0022cf21a0a47a1d2 Auto-generated-cl: translation import
* Update install-permission logic to use new FLAG_PRIVILEGEDChristopher Tate2013-06-141-5/+5
| | | | | | | | | | | We no longer grant all "signatureOrSystem" type permissions to all apps bundled on the system partition; there is a build-time grant of privileged status. The logic for granting install permission now checks the caller's privileged status, not just its apk location. Bug 8765951 Change-Id: Ib88f4b0911743bd6bfd3458302fe88518e08ac86
* Import translations. DO NOT MERGEBaligh Uddin2013-05-271-3/+3
| | | | | Change-Id: I10a76f5b6f5f8a206a491496bf1dad8c988bf722 Auto-generated-cl: translation import
* Import translations. DO NOT MERGEBaligh Uddin2013-05-031-5/+5
| | | | | Change-Id: I55d2da6adfe3d14de275bb18bb95b429f20efe89 Auto-generated-cl: translation import
* Import translations. DO NOT MERGEBaligh Uddin2013-04-291-1/+1
| | | | | Change-Id: I2b05bfa888728f46ee24305806a6d848f6b484b1 Auto-generated-cl: translation import
* am b1a5960a: Import translations. DO NOT MERGEBaligh Uddin2013-04-230-0/+0
|\ | | | | | | | | * commit 'b1a5960af6814e38ae7dcd771d25c1d8ab1dcae6': Import translations. DO NOT MERGE